Transaction 20c84a6aca62b521b329cc06e09385ce5d2eb129bb732f4058f4545bfa39302d
1 Input
1 Output
-
20c84a6aca62b521b329cc06e09385ce5d2eb129bb732f4058f4545bfa39302d:0
- value
- 340374
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f4be87dca3cd39e2e41f2598e36cbd6ca396bfa OP_EQUAL
- address
- 38vJEtbfDCz1MCpLgsJzrQ1LKynMoUBJiL